Seattle Sounders FC Forward Raúl Ruídiaz Voted MLS Player of the Week for Week 20

Raul Ruidiaz SEA cele

NEW YORK (Thursday, Aug. 19, 2021) – Seattle Sounders FC forward Raúl Ruidíaz has been voted the Major League Soccer Player of the Week for Week 20 of the 2021 MLS season.

Ruidíaz came off the substitutes’ bench to score the only goal of the game in Sounders FC’s win against FC Dallas at Toyota Stadium on Wednesday evening.

Just 25 seconds after Ruidíaz was brought into the game in the 63rd minute, he collected a pass in the penalty area from Nicolás Lodeiro. His first attempt toward goal was blocked, but Ruidíaz grabbed the rebound and curled a shot which clipped the underside of the crossbar before bouncing just over the goal line and into the net (WATCH HERE).

The goal was the 14th of the season for Ruidíaz, leading the standings for the MLS Golden Boot presented by Audi, two goals ahead of Gustavo Bou of the New England Revolution and Daniel Sallói of Sporting Kansas City.

Ruidíaz was named MLS Player of the Week for the third time and the second consecutive week, after winning the honor for Week 19. He’s the second player to be named Player of the Week in back-to-back weeks this season, after Javier Hernández of the LA Galaxy was so honored in the opening two weeks of the season.

The MLS Player of the Week is selected each week of the regular season through both media and fan voting in a process conducted by MLS Communications. A panel of journalists from the North American Soccer Reporters (NASR) comprises 75 percent of the vote, while a Twitter fan vote represents the remaining 25 percent of voting. NASR consists of members of print, television, radio and online media.
